Development characteristics of interlayer oxidation reduction zone and associated uranium mineralization in tertiary in Shebotu area, Songliao basin

Description

Songliao basin is a Meso-Cenozoic continental basin superimposed on the Hercynian fold belt. Shebotu area is located in the southwest of Songliao basin where three sandstone beds exist in Neogene loose sediments. Regional interlayer oxidation zones of various scale are developed in sand bodies. Drilling has revealed that typical interlayer oxidation zone is developed in sand body No.II in Yushutun, and the redox zone is associated with the secondary concentration of uranium and molybdenum. This discovery presents bright prospects for the final progress in uranium prospecting in Songliao basin
